Introduction: What is visual communication?

Visual communication is the process of transferring information or ideas through the use of visual aids. This can include images, symbols, graphs, and diagrams. Visual communication is especially effective in situations where words cannot accurately convey the information. It can be used to simplify complex concepts, improve understanding, and boost retention rates.

Charts:

Charts are a form of visual communication used to display quantitative relationships. They can be used to show comparisons between data sets, or to illustrate how a value changes over time. Charts are often used in business and academic settings, but can also be helpful for personal finance and other life decisions. There are many different types of charts, each with its own strengths and weaknesses. When choosing a chart to use, it is important to consider the audience, the data, and the goal of the presentation.

Maps:

Maps are a form of visual communication that can be used to depict a variety of information. They can show physical features, like mountains and rivers, or political boundaries. Maps can also show demographic information, like population density or unemployment rates. The use of maps can help people understand complex information quickly and easily. Diagrams:

A diagram is a visual representation of information or ideas. It can be used to illustrate a process, to show the relationships between different parts of a system, or to display data. Diagrams are an important form of visual communication, and they can be used to explain complex concepts in a clear and concise way. The best tools for creating visual content 

Visual content has become an important part of online marketing. It can be used to create engaging and interactive content that can help you stand out from the competition. There are a number of tools that you can use to create visual content, including:

  1. Adobe Photoshop- This software is used for creating digital images and graphics. It offers a wide range of features, including layers, masks, and filters.
  2. Adobe Illustrator- This software is used for creating vector illustrations. It offers a wide range of features, including brushes, colours, and effects.
  3. Adobe InDesign- This software is designed for creating mock-ups, brochures, and technical documentation. It offers a wide range of features, including layout, text, and graphics.
  4. PowerPoint- This software is used to create presentations such as slideshows.
  5. Adobe After Effects- This software is designed for creating video and animations. It offers a wide range of features, including special effects and filters.
